Web26 apr. 2024 · If you’re wondering, “Should I itemize?” the answer is yes but only if the total of your itemized deductions exceeds the value of your standard tax deduction. The standard deductions for each filing status are: Single: $12,400. Head of Household: $18,650. Married Filing Jointly or Qualifying Widow (er): $24,800.

Itemizing most often … how many people have my birthdayWeb24 jun. 2024 · Itemized deductions are expenses you have paid throughout the year that can be subtracted from your adjustable gross income (AGI) when calculating your tax liability. This means that the income used to calculate how much tax you owe might be less, and therefore the amount you must pay might be less.
